Transaction 2be77ecb488350dd5cca4da06cd00e626f528c5c37e12776550003e2897fa6c8
1 Input
1 Output
-
2be77ecb488350dd5cca4da06cd00e626f528c5c37e12776550003e2897fa6c8:0
- value
- 522860
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 02420040959aea749b5e085d0c2d5ebb1897f309 OP_EQUAL
- address
- 31txLkpP7F6fyLJxfFEctSq7gzpgunf6SW